I had Salmon bay all to myself for 4+ hrs on a 20-27kts S/SW.

What a sweet spot!! Great vista. Nice casual sheltered Sth end for squids and howling reasonably flatwater main section with some bombys out back... so very sweet I almost got a cavity As you can see my teeth are ok though.

Watch out for very shallow reef up the sheltered south end, I climbed the dunes to give the joint a good squiz 1st and was glad i did - lots n lots of gnarley just hidden reef waiting to bite. Nup - sorry don't agree - the kids buggies are way cool. I got 2 kites, board, vest , helmet, BnLines, harness, towel, drinks, change of clothes, wetty and almost a kitchen sink in there with room to move... no waiting and no struggling on the bus with gear clocking people's melons as you go bye. I think the last bus goes past about 5 ish too so that's a bit of a drag.

Daily rate for a buggy/trailer is exxy at $16 but only $6 per day from there. They hold much, much more gear on them than dive trailers too. I used both and the buggies coast better than the clapped out trailers also. Only hassle is they do act as a wind anchor on the way there and some parts the way back.
